summ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Daniel Black <dragonheart@gentoo.org>2004-05-05 08:12:53 +0000
committerDaniel Black <dragonheart@gentoo.org>2004-05-05 08:12:53 +0000
commitfedaf15623b70dd86ccfd55e48fcd7b3f0b6c254 (patch)
treed716921c09e3ea33abef8a7ba814245fc398124f /dev-util/gperf
parentInitial import of mips32, a derivative of the sparc32 utility for mips64 syst... (diff)
downloadhistorical-fedaf15623b70dd86ccfd55e48fcd7b3f0b6c254.tar.gz
historical-fedaf15623b70dd86ccfd55e48fcd7b3f0b6c254.tar.bz2
historical-fedaf15623b70dd86ccfd55e48fcd7b3f0b6c254.zip
QA Fix to docdir. Fixed bug #46565
Diffstat (limited to 'dev-util/gperf')
-rw-r--r--dev-util/gperf/ChangeLog6
-rw-r--r--dev-util/gperf/Manifest5
-rw-r--r--dev-util/gperf/gperf-2.7.2.ebuild11
-rw-r--r--dev-util/gperf/metadata.xml9
4 files changed, 27 insertions, 4 deletions
diff --git a/dev-util/gperf/ChangeLog b/dev-util/gperf/ChangeLog
index 914b7c483290..7a5e1cd56c1b 100644
--- a/dev-util/gperf/ChangeLog
+++ b/dev-util/gperf/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for dev-util/gperf
# Copyright 2002-2004 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-util/gperf/ChangeLog,v 1.13 2004/04/29 13:56:11 fmccor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-util/gperf/ChangeLog,v 1.14 2004/05/05 08:12:53 dragonheart Exp $
+
+ 05 May 2004; Daniel Black <dragonheart@gentoo.org> +metadata.xml,
+ gperf-2.7.2.ebuild:
+ QA Fix to docdir. Fixed bug #46565
29 Apr 2004; Ferris McCormick <fmccor@gentoo.org> gperf-3.0.1.ebuild:
Stable on sparc.
diff --git a/dev-util/gperf/Manifest b/dev-util/gperf/Manifest
index 1d86a3571b4b..fdae7720dfca 100644
--- a/dev-util/gperf/Manifest
+++ b/dev-util/gperf/Manifest
@@ -1,5 +1,6 @@
-MD5 e6791955e046b939d8a8b7730a7809d8 ChangeLog 1253
-MD5 6fe6fc869d38a00442d1e7139c838b98 gperf-2.7.2.ebuild 556
+MD5 eb39ff15d16c93c97f32b2bb45145462 ChangeLog 1386
+MD5 ec1ab1b791e07978101db58d4232a761 gperf-2.7.2.ebuild 778
+MD5 1652522405f5936eb29776ef8d5ffa5b metadata.xml 310
MD5 481cbea32739d4aa7bf9f12e5f2e496f gperf-3.0.1.ebuild 557
MD5 ec1cc9b13d8e32fc5d07f728b58f8fe9 files/digest-gperf-2.7.2 63
MD5 748cbc76e71cf034e58e6eae1ad118e4 files/digest-gperf-3.0.1 63
diff --git a/dev-util/gperf/gperf-2.7.2.ebuild b/dev-util/gperf/gperf-2.7.2.ebuild
index 28716cda59ee..80f3403fce70 100644
--- a/dev-util/gperf/gperf-2.7.2.ebuild
+++ b/dev-util/gperf/gperf-2.7.2.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2004 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/dev-util/gperf/gperf-2.7.2.ebuild,v 1.13 2004/02/18 13:08:18 agriffis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-util/gperf/gperf-2.7.2.ebuild,v 1.14 2004/05/05 08:12:53 dragonheart Exp $
S=${WORKDIR}/${P}
DESCRIPTION="A perfect hash function generator."
@@ -11,8 +11,17 @@ SLOT="0"
LICENSE="GPL-2"
KEYWORDS="x86 ppc sparc alpha amd64 hppa ia64"
+RDEPEND="virtual/glibc
+ >=sys-apps/sed"
+
DEPEND="virtual/glibc"
+src_compile() {
+ sed -i -e "s#^docdir = \$(prefix).*#docdir = @datadir@/doc/${PF}#" doc/Makefile.in
+ econf || die "died during configuration"
+ emake || die "died during make"
+}
+
src_install () {
make DESTDIR=${D} install || die
}
diff --git a/dev-util/gperf/metadata.xml b/dev-util/gperf/metadata.xml
new file mode 100644
index 000000000000..d8b96be3c5cd
--- /dev/null
+++ b/dev-util/gperf/metadata.xml
@@ -0,0 +1,9 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<herd>no-herd</herd>
+ <maintainer>
+ <email>bug-wranglers@gentoo.org</email>
+ <description>This package lacks a primary herd or maintainer.</description>
+ </maintainer>
+</pkgmetadata>